body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,form,fieldset,input,p,blockquote,th,td{margin:0;padding:0}table{border-spacing:0}form{display:inline}body,html{width:100%; height:100%}body{  font-size:       13px;  font-family:     "Times New Roman",serif;  text-align:      center;  background:      #aea997 url('img/bg.jpg') top;  color:           #5e5c53}table{  text-align:      left;  font-size:       13px;  font-family:     "Times New Roman",serif}form {display:    inline}a img{border:0px}a:link,a:visited{  color:           #727067;  font-style:      italic;  outline:         0}a:hover{  color:           #9f9587}p{  margin:          12px 0px;  text-align:      justify}ul p{  text-align:      left}h1{  font-weight:     normal;  font-style:      italic;  font-size:       30px}h2{  font-weight:     normal;  font-style:      italic;  font-size:       21px}hr{  border:          0;  border-top:      1px solid #cecac2;  border-bottom:   1px solid #fff;  height:          2px;  clear:           left;  margin:          5px 0}#box .content ul{  margin-left:     13px;  text-align:      justify}#prostokaty{  position:        absolute;  top:             500px;  left:            42px;  z-index:-1;  display:         none}.floatright{      float:right}.floatleft {      float:left}.hidden    {      display:none}.nolink    {      cursor:default}#dla_mlodziezy{  display:         none;  background:      url('img/arr_right.png') top right no-repeat; color: #f8f7f4; font-size: 14px; width: 200px; height: 16px; padding-right: 22px; position: absolute; top: 93px; left: 670px; z-index: 1; text-decoration: none !important; text-align: right}#page{ width: 1000px; height: 575px; position: relative; margin: 0 auto}#logo{  position:        absolute;  top:             30px;  left:            120px;  width:           261px;  height:          78px;  background:      url('img/logo.png') top no-repeat}#logo a{           display:block;width:100%;height:100%}#logo span{       display:none}#pg_index .content object,#pg_index .content embed{  position:        relative;  top:             2px;  left:            1px}#preload{  display:         block;  width:           1px;  height:          1px;  overflow:        hidden;  position:        absolute;  top:             0;right:0}#copyright{  display:         block;  width:           145px;  height:          13px;  background:      url('img/menu.png') 0px -152px no-repeat; position: absolute; left: 753px; top: 560px; text-indent: -10000px; outline: 0}#header{ position: absolute; top: 82px; left: 420px}h1#title{ display: block; width: 550px;  height: 13px; position: absolute; left: 348px; top: 69px; font-size: 40px; letter-spacing: -0.03em; text-align: right; text-transform: lowercase}h2#subtitle{ color: #f8f7f4; font-size: 28px; display: block; width: 550px; position: absolute; left: 220px; top: 480px}#search{ position: absolute; top: 10px; left: 700px}#search input{ background-color:#afab98; border: 1px solid #837e68; margin-right: 2px; *padding: 0 3px}#search input[type="text"]{ position: relative; top: -1px; height: 18px; *top: 0px; *height: 16px}#nav_l{  display:         block;  background:      url('img/arr2_left.png') top left no-repeat;  font-size:       13px;  width:           15px;  height:          17px;  padding-left:    22px;  position:        absolute;  top:             480px;  left:            115px;  z-index:         1;  text-decoration: none !important}#nav_r{  display:         block;  background:      url('img/arr2_right.png') top right no-repeat;  font-size:       13px;  width:           15px;  height:          17px;  padding-right:   34px;  position:        absolute;  top:             480px;  left:            555px;  z-index:         1;  text-decoration: none !important}#box,#box2{  position:        absolute;  top:             130px;  left:            100px;  height:          380px}.content{  text-align:      left}#pg_index #box{  width:           800px;  margin:          0 auto;  background:      url('img/page_bg.png') top no-repeat}#pg_index .content{  width:           788px;  height:          380px;  margin:          5px;  margin-top:      4px}#pg_txt #box{  width:           516px;  background:      url('img/page_bg2.png') top no-repeat;  display:         table;  overflow:        hidden;  left:            100px;  font-size:       13px}#pg_txt #box .content{  padding:         10px 25px 25px 25px;  display:         table-cell;  vertical-align:  middle}#box #strona #box2 .content{  padding:         6px}#pg_txt #box table td{  padding:         2px 4px;  border-bottom:   1px solid #c1bdab}#pg_txt #box2{  left:            615px;  width:           286px;  background:      url('img/page_bg3.png') top no-repeat}#pg_txt #box2 .content{  position:        relative;  top:             6px;  left:            6px;  height:          100%}#pg_txt #box2 .content div{  width:           273px;  height:          368px}#pg_txt #box2 .content div a{  width:           100%;  height:          100%;  display:         block}#pg_aktualnosci #box{  width:           800px;  margin:          0 auto;  background:      url('img/page_bg6.png') top no-repeat;  display:         table}#pg_aktualnosci .content{  display:         table-cell;  padding:         0 25px 25px 25px;  vertical-align:  middle}#pg_aktualnosci h2{  margin-top:      30px}#pg_aktualnosci #nav_r{  left:            842px}.arrow1_left{  display:         block;  background:      url('img/arr_left.png') 0 0 no-repeat;  font-size:       13px;  width:           110px;  height:          16px;  padding-left:    22px;  position:        absolute;  top:             490px;  left:            106px;  z-index:         1;  text-decoration: none !important;  text-align:      left}.arrow1_right{  display:         block;  background:      url('img/arr_right.png') top right no-repeat;  font-size:       13px;  width:           110px;  height:          16px;  padding-right:   22px;  position:        absolute;  top:             480px;  left:            106px;  z-index:         1;  text-decoration: none !important;  text-align:      right}#pg_oferta #nav_r{  background:      url('img/arr2_right.png') top left no-repeat;  left:            842px;  top:             490px;  padding-right:   auto;  padding-left:    22px;  color:           #f8f7f4}#pg_oferta #nav_l{  background:      url('img/arr2_left.png') top right no-repeat; left: 760px; top: 490px; padding-right: 43px; padding-left: auto; color: #f8f7f4}#pg_oferta #nav_r:hover,#pg_oferta #nav_l:hover{ color: #ebe9e4}#navbar,#navbar ul{list-style:none}#navbar{  width:           798px;  height:          39px;  background:      url('img/pasek_menu.png') top no-repeat;  position:        absolute;  top:             520px;  left:            101px;  font-family:     "Times New Roman",serif;  font-size:       12px;  color:           #727067}#navbar li{  float:           left;  position:        absolute}#navbar li a b{  text-indent:     -10000px;  display:         block;  width:           100%;  height:          100%;  background:      url('img/dot.png') right no-repeat; background: none}#navbar li a{ display: block; position: absolute; outline: 0; width: 100%; height: 100%; z-index: 1}#navbar li ul{  display:         none;  text-align:      left;  height:          162px;  width:           95px}#navbar li:hover ul,#navbar li.hover ul{  display:         table;  position:        absolute;  top:             -162px;  left:            2px}#navbar li li{  float:           none;  position:        relative;  height:          100%;  display:         table-cell;  vertical-align:  bottom}#navbar li li a:link,#navbar li li a:visited{  position:        relative;  padding-top:     6px;  height:          auto;  padding-bottom:  6px;  padding-right:   6px;  width:           89px;  *width:          95px;  text-decoration: none;  color:           #727067;  background:      url('img/bg1.png') top left;  margin-bottom:   1px;  text-align:      right;    *margin-bottom:  0px;  *border-bottom:  1px solid #bfbba9;  margin-bottom:   0\9;  border-bottom:   1px solid #bfbba9\9}#navbar li li a:hover{  color:           #f2f1ec;  background:      url('img/bg2.png') top left}#m1{  display:         block;  width:           145px;  height:          30px;  background:      url('img/menu.png') 71px 6px no-repeat;  left:            2px;  top:             4px}#m2{  display:         block;  width:           130px;  height:          30px;  background:      url('img/menu.png') 44px -18px no-repeat;  left:            148px;  top:             4px}#m3{  display:         block;  width:           108px;  height:          30px;  background:      url('img/menu.png') 27px -95px no-repeat;  left:            279px;  top:             4px}#m4{  display:         block;  width:           175px;  height:          30px;  background:      url('img/menu.png') 15px -45px no-repeat;  left:            388px;  top:             4px}#m5{  display:         block;  width:           86px;  height:          30px;  background:      url('img/menu.png') 10px -70px no-repeat;  left:            564px;  top:             4px}#m6{  display:         block;  width:           142px;  height:          30px;  background:      url('img/menu.png') 18px -120px no-repeat; left: 651px; top: 4px}#m1 ul{ left: 50px !important}#m2 ul{ left: 20px !important}#m3 ul{ left: -7px !important}#m4 ul{ left: 20px !important}#m5 ul{ left: -25px !important}#m6 ul{ left: 0px !important}#tabela_kategorii{ width: 790px; height: 288px; position: absolute; top: 180px; left: 105px}#tabela_kategorii th,#tabela_kategorii td{ vertical-align: top; padding: 0 1px 0px 0}#tabela_kategorii th{ padding-right: 3px; width: 162px}#tabela_kategorii td{ width: 155px}#tabela_kategorii th a{ background-color:#72635a; color: #e6dfce; display: block; text-align: right; text-transform: uppercase; text-decoration: none; font-weight: normal; font-style: normal; font-size: 10px; letter-spacing: 0.1em; padding: 10px 8px 10px 0; margin-bottom: 1px}#tabela_kategorii th a:hover{ background-color:#675a52}#tabela_kategorii th a.nolink:hover{ background-color:#72635a}#tabela_kategorii th a.aranzacje{ background-color:#e6dfce; color: #72635a}#tabela_kategorii th a.aranzacje:hover{ background-color:#dfd8c6}#tabela_kategorii td a{ background-color:#e6dfce; color: #72635a; display: block; text-align: center; text-decoration: none; font-style: normal; padding: 8px 10px 7px 0; margin-bottom: 1px}#tabela_kategorii td a:hover{ background-color:#dfd8c6}.lista_produktow_1{  width:           810px;  height:          147px;  position:        absolute;  top:             157px;  left:            105px;  font-size:       16px;  font-style:      italic;  text-align:      left}.lista_produktow_1 div,.lista_produktow_2 div{  width:           185px;  height:          100%;  float:           left;  margin-right:    16px;  background-color:#72635a;  position:        relative}.lista_produktow_1 .cena{  background:     url('img/bg50w.png') transparent; width: 173px; *width: 185px; height: 18px; *height: 20px; padding: 1px 6px; position: absolute; top: 0; color: #72635a; text-align: right; font-size: 15px}.lista_produktow_1 a:link,.lista_produktow_1 a:visited,.lista_produktow_2 a:link,.lista_produktow_2 a:visited{ color: white; text-decoration: none}.lista_produktow_1 a:hover,.lista_produktow_2 a:hover{ color: #f1e6e0}.lista_produktow_1 span,.lista_produktow_2 span{ display: block; margin-left: 5px}.lista_produktow_2{ width: 810px; height: 147px; position: absolute; top: 320px; left: 105px; font-size: 16px; font-style: italic; text-align: left}#komunikat{ position: relative; top: 300px}#pg_txt #komunikat,#pg_produkt1 #komunikat{ top: 0px}.notka_promo{ width: 790px; height: 50px; position: absolute; top: 476px; left: 105px; text-align: left; font-size: 12px; line-height: 13px}#pg_produkt1 #box{  width:           204px;  height:          379px;  background:      url('img/page_bg4.png') top left no-repeat;  display:         table;  overflow:        hidden;  left:            100px}#pg_produkt1 #box .content{  padding:         5px 25px;  display:         table-cell;  vertical-align:  middle}#pg_produkt1 #box2{  left:            300px;  top:             129px;  width:           600px;  height:          380px;  background:      url('img/page_bg5.png') top left no-repeat}#pg_produkt1 #box2 .content{  position:        relative;  top:             7px;  left:            10px}#pg_produkt1 #box table{  clear:           both;  margin:          1px 0}#pg_produkt1 #box h1{  clear:           both} #pg_produkt1 #nav_r{  left:            223px;  width:           50px;  background:      url('img/arr2_right.png') top right no-repeat;  text-align:      right;  padding-right:   20px}.pg_produkt2 #nav_l{  background:      url('img/arr2_left.png') top left no-repeat; padding-left: 22px; left: 115px; top: 480px} #pg_produkt1 .arrow1_left{ top: 480px; left: 115px; width: 55px}.pg_produkt2 .arrow1_left{ top: 480px; left: 180px; width: 55px}.pg_produkt2 .arrow1_right{ left: auto; right: 400px; top: 457px}.pg_produkt2 .arrow1_right_lower{ top: 480px; width: 140px}#pg_produkt1 #box p{ text-align: left}#pg_produkt1 #plus{ position: absolute; top: 0; right: 15px}.cena{ background-color:#f8f7f4; font-size: 13px; right: 400px; padding: 0 5px; position: absolute; text-align: right; text-decoration: none !important; top: 480px; z-index: 1; font-style: italic}.cena:hover{color:#5E5C53} #koszyk{  text-align:     right;  width:          300px;  position:       absolute;  top:            80px;  left:           595px;  background:     url('img/koszyk1.png') top right no-repeat}#koszyk a:link,#koszyk a:visited{ font-style: normal; text-decoration: none; margin-right: 40px; display: block; margin-top: -2px}#koszyk a:hover{ color: #727067; text-decoration: underline}#produkt1 #koszyk_add{ position: absolute; top: 480px; left: 130px}#pg_txt #koszyk_add{ position: absolute; top: 480px; right: 400px}#tabela_koszyka{ width: 790px; position: absolute; top: 180px; left: 105px}#tabela_koszyka th,#tabela_koszyka td{ vertical-align: top; padding: 0 1px 0px 0}#tabela_koszyka th{ padding-right: 3px; width: 162px}#tabela_koszyka td{ width: 155px; position: relative}#tabela_koszyka th a{ background-color:#72635a; color: #e6dfce; display: block; text-align: right; text-transform: uppercase; text-decoration: none; font-weight: normal; font-style: normal; font-size: 10px; letter-spacing: 0.1em; padding: 10px 8px 10px 0; margin-bottom: 1px}#tabela_koszyka th a:hover{ background-color:#675a52}#tabela_koszyka td a{ background-color:#e6dfce; color: #72635a; display: block; text-align: center; text-decoration: none; font-style: normal; padding: 8px 10px 7px 0; margin-bottom: 1px}#tabela_koszyka td a:hover{ background-color:#dfd8c6}#tabela_koszyka td a.usun{ display: inline; width: 4px; height: 5px; padding: 0; font-size: 9px; font-family: arial; float: right; position: relative; bottom: 40px; right: 5px; color: red}#tabela_koszyka td a.usun:hover{ color: #a00}#tabela_koszyka .tabela_bgblock{ background-color:#e6dfce; color: #72635a; padding: 12px 5px 10px 10px; margin-bottom: 4px}#tabela_koszyka .tabela_bgblock input[type="text"]{ width: 200px; margin: 0 5px 4px 0; border-top: #aaadb2 1px solid; border-right: #aaadb2 1px solid; border-bottom: #e2e9ef 1px solid; border-left: #e2e9ef 1px solid}#tabela_koszyka .tabela_bgblock input[type="text"]:hover{ background-color:#fcf9f3}#tabela_koszyka .tabela_bgblock input[type="submit"]{ margin-top: 4px; margin-bottom: -5px}#tabela_koszyka .tabela_bgblock input[type="text"].redb,#tabela_koszyka .tabela_bgblock textarea.redb{ border: 1px solid red}#tabela_koszyka .tabela_bgblock a{ text-decoration: underline} .formularz_kontaktowy input{ width: 300px; margin-top: 1px}.formularz_kontaktowy textarea{ width: 300px; height: 100px}.formularz_kontaktowy .submit{ width: 50px}#map{ position: absolute; top: 4px; left: 5px; width: 788px; height: 370px; border: 1px solid gray; overflow: hidden}#pg_txt.str_kontakt #box table td,#pg_txt.str_id_7 #box table td{ padding: 0}#pg_txt #box #box2{ top:0\9; left:515px\9}#pg_txt #box #box2 .content{ padding-left:0\9; padding-top: 0\9}#tabela_koszyka .tabela_bgblock{ padding-top: 5px\9; padding-bottom:5px\9}#search input{ padding: 1px 4px\9}#search input[type="text"]{ top: 0px\9; height: 16px\9}@media all and (-webkit-min-device-pixel-ratio:10000),not all and (-webkit-min-device-pixel-ratio:0){ #pg_txt #box #box2{ top: 0; left: auto; right: -285px}}
